It’s high time more NYers know of NYC’s Fair Chance for Housing Act! As of 1/1/25, the law bans housing discrimination against ppl w/ convictions across NYC. Our guide covers the law & offers recs to help justice-involved NYers find a place to call home: https://t.co/uwiMbctPah

Earlier this year, Amour Castillo, a Project Manager for the Center for Research, Inquiry, and Social Justice (CRIS-J) and a Ph.D. candidate, attended the Academic Consortium on Criminal Justice Health, a national conference focused on health and criminal justice.
Amour presented the Rapid Qualitative Analysis process used by Fortune, underscoring the importance of incorporating the perspectives and ideas of Fortune’s community members into their work.

If you receive SNAP, you may be subject to new Federal work requirements that could impact your SNAP benefits. You can meet the work requirements and keep your SNAP benefits if you:
✔️ Earn at least $943 a month, or $217.50 per week
✔️ Do community service or volunteer work
✔️ Learn skills to help you get a job
